Make a pledge -- plant a tree.
NEPR has partnered with the Connecticut River Watershed Council and several area nurseries to distribute 2600 trees to local environmental organizations who are working to restore areas of the Connecticut River affected by the June tornadoes, the August storm and flooding, and the October nor'easter.
So, for every contribution made to support WFCR and WNNZ during the current fund drive (February 24 – March 3), a tree will be planted in our community -- a tree to replace one of the thousands of trees lost or severely damaged.
